Stainless long-life ball valves

When Worcester Controls' valves and Norbro actuators were installed at a fine chemicals manufacturing plant in Middlesbrough in 1997 they had a target to achieve one million uninterrupted cycles.

Compact valves are fully flushable

Lee Products has extended its LFV series of chemically inert solenoid valves to include a flange mount version which enables them to be grouped together very closely on 13mm centres.

Tokyo’s first hydrogen refuelling station

Showa Shell Sekiyu KK (Showa Shell) is to build the first hydrogen refuelling station in Tokyo, in partnership with Iwatani International Corporation and the Tokyo Metropolitan Government.

Emerson to supply Motiva refinery

Emerson Process Management has received a USD 1 million contract for front-end engineering and design (FEED), and project execution services as the main automation contractor (MAC) for a major automation program at Motiva Enterprises' Norco Refinery, located in Norco, Louisiana, USA.

ABB wins Sakhalin order

ABB has signed a contract worth USD 987 million with Exxon Neftegas Ltd, to develop onshore oil and gas processing and well-site support facilities on Russia’s Sakhalin Island, in the Sea of Okhotsk.

Figure 800 safety relief valve

Spence Engineering Company Inc., Walden, New York has announced the Figure 800 Safety Relief Valve with all stainless steel internals for improved corrosion resistance.

Saudi gas deals to be restructured?

Talks between Saudi Arabia and its main foreign partners in three mega-gas ventures have "broken down in deadlock, leaving the future of the project in its current shape in doubt," the Middle East Economic Survey (MEES has reported.
